HIV controller CD4+ T cells respond to minimal amounts of Gag antigen due to high TCR avidity.

HIV controllers are rare individuals who spontaneously control HIV replication in the absence of antiretroviral treatment. Emerging evidence indicates that HIV control is mediated through very active cellular immune responses, though how such responses can persist over time without immune exhaustion...
